What Causes High Blood Pressure Inspite Of Taking Cozaar?

I've been in a high stress situation for 2 days and my b.p. Has been as high as 180/116 and won't go below 155/98. I'm on 100 mg Cozaar and it normally doesn't exceed 135/85. Planning to call dr in the morning. Anything else I can do in the interim?

Cardiologist 's  Response
Hi,

Cozaar will take some time to act, if there is no chest pain, headache or shortness of breath, then there is not urgency of getting down bp. You monitor it thrice a day and if still remains high then need to add some more medicine usually Amlodipine. You can get this prescribed from local doctor. Also use some relaxation techniques like yoga and regular exercises to reduce stress. Also have low salt diet, healthy food. Get your lipid and sugars tested. Avoid smoking and alcohol if any.
